什么是"页面没有链接"?

这个问题的意思是页面上找到0个链出链接,这种链接也被称为"死胡同页面",因为这个页面并没有其他可追随的链接,爬虫一定会在这里停止。有时候这个问题是因为链接是置于Flash,JavaScript或其他爬虫无法读取的元素内。

为什么这个问题值得关注?

死胡同页面是应该避免的,虽然它们不一定会损害网站的排名,不过对用户体验不好,也会令网站失去了一个内部链接的机会。

  • 它们会损害你的内部链接策略,所有死胡同页面的外链权重传递都会在这里停止不再传递,这令你浪费了一个将外链权重传递到其他页面的机会。例如:当一个页面有大量的外链链到,这个页面的价值会相对较高,当这个页面链到站内的其他页面,它可以同时提升这些页面的价值,但如果这个页面没有链接到任何其他页面,所有外链的价值都只能令这个页面受惠。
  • 如果一个页面因为使用Flash,JavaScript或其他爬虫无法识别的元素导致死胡同,搜索引擎有机会只能抓取或收录这个页面。
  • 死胡同页面是不自然和对用户体验不好的。互联网的本质是使用链结把页面链在一起,如果页面没有链接,用户就必须使用浏览器的返回键或离开网站,带死胡同页面的网站结构也会为爬虫制造额外的工作。

如何修复

确保每个页面都至少包含几个链接。并确保这些链接能够被搜索引擎读取,不要用Flash,JavaScript等等。绝大部份情况下你应该在每个页面使用纯文字的导航列。

Did this answer your question?